Local name in Hire an employee quick action

edited Apr 15, 2020 12:43PM in Human Capital Management 8 comments

Summary

Cannot see local name in hire an employee

Content

Hi -

We are currently configuring the hire an employee quick action and could not find the local name check box and it's corresponding fields.  We could not find a way to configure this in the HCM Experience Design Studio.

We were able to make it visible via page composer.

Is this the right way to go and have others made it available?  We want to make sure this is the right way since we though HCM Experience Design Studio should be the way to go and don't want to make fields visible using different methods.
